Современная индустрия разработки видеоигр находится в постоянном развитии, отражая тенденции в технологиях и организациях труда. Крупные игровые студии, сталкиваясь с растущей сложностью проектов и глобальными вызовами, все чаще обращаются к новым парадигмам управления и разработки. Среди них особое место занимают микроуслуги и удалённые команды, которые значительно меняют не только процессы создания игр, но и корпоративную культуру внутри организаций.
В данной статье рассмотрим, каким образом внедрение микроуслуг и использование удалённых команд трансформируют рабочие процессы и влияют на корпоративную культуру в крупных игровых студиях. Мы проанализируем преимущества, вызовы, а также практические инструменты, способствующие успешной интеграции этих подходов.
Микроуслуги в разработке игр: новые горизонты архитектуры
Микроуслуги представляют собой архитектурный стиль, при котором программное обеспечение разбивается на набор небольших, автономных и независимых сервисов. В игровой индустрии это помогает разбить монолитные проекты на управляемые компоненты. Каждая команда может сосредоточиться на своей области, что повышает эффективность и сокращает время выхода новых функций.
Использование микроуслуг способствует гибкости разработки и масштабируемости. Например, игровой движок, серверы многопользовательских режимов, системы управления прогрессом и аналитика могут быть реализованы как отдельные сервисы. Это упрощает обновления, тестирование и развертывание, а также позволяет использовать оптимальные технологии для каждой задачи.
Преимущества микроуслуг для игровых студий
- Масштабируемость — независимая работа компонентов облегчает увеличение нагрузки и добавление новых функций;
- Быстрота разработки — команды могут параллельно работать над разными сервисами, сокращая время релиза;
- Устойчивость системы — сбой одной службы не приводит к падению всей игры;
- Технологическая независимость — возможность использовать разные языки программирования и инструменты в рамках одного проекта.
Технические сложности и вызовы микроуслуг
Несмотря на многочисленные плюсы, переход на микроуслуги требует решения ряда технических и организационных задач. Особенно это остро чувствуется в игровых студиях, где требования к производительности и стабильности крайне высоки.
Ключевые сложности включают в себя управление взаимодействием сервисов, мониторинг и логирование, обеспечение безопасности, а также необходимость в развитии DevOps-культуры. Из-за распределённой структуры приложения возрастает сложность выявления ошибок и диагностики, что требует инструментальных решений и процедур поддержки.
Удалённые команды: новый формат сотрудничества
Удалённая работа стала неотъемлемой частью современной индустрии разработки игр. Крупные студии все чаще формируют hybride или полностью распределённые команды, что открывает доступ к глобальному пулу талантов и снижает операционные издержки.
Удалённые команды позволяют привлечь специалистов из разных стран и часовых поясов, что особенно важно для проектов с масштабной мультирегиональной аудиторией. Такой подход обеспечивает более гибкий график работы и способствует инклюзивности в подборе персонала.
Выгоды для игровых студий от работы с удалёнными командами
- Расширение кадрового ресурса — возможность нанять лучших специалистов независимо от географии;
- Снижение затрат — уменьшение расходов на офисную инфраструктуру и связанные с ней издержки;
- Гибкость планирования — команды могут работать в удобное время, повышая продуктивность;
- Круглосуточный рабочий цикл — благодаря разным часовых поясам становится возможна непрерывная разработка и поддержка проектов.
Проблемы организации удалённой работы
Удалённая работа в игровой индустрии зачастую связана с рисками потери командного духа и сложностями коммуникации. Без юридического и культурного единства между членами команды возникают трудности в согласовании решений и отслеживании прогресса.
Кроме того, на удалёнке сложно контролировать качество и вовлечённость сотрудников, что может сказаться на конечном продукте. Для преодоления этих барьеров необходимо внедрение эффективных коммуникационных и организационных практик, поддержка менторства и регулярное проведение виртуальных мероприятий.
Влияние микроуслуг и удалённых команд на рабочий процесс
Интеграция микроуслуг и удалённой работы изменяет классическую модель разработки игр. Процессы становятся более модульными, а коммуникация — более формализованной и технологичной.
Команды, фокусирующиеся на конкретных сервисах или функциях, работают автономно, что создаёт необходимость синхронизации через цифровые инструменты. В итоге меняется подход к планированию, проверке качества и выпуску обновлений, что требует от менеджеров и разработчиков новых компетенций.
Ключевые изменения в рабочем процессе
Традиционный подход | Подход с микроуслугами и удалёнными командами |
---|---|
Монолитный код, единый релиз | Разделение на сервисы с независимыми релизами |
Очные совещания и встречи | Виртуальные коммуникации с использованием видеоконференций и мессенджеров |
Централизованное управление задачами | Децентрализованное управление с применением Agile-инструментов и досок задач |
Планирование по полуторагодовым циклам | Гибкое планирование с частыми итерациями и релизами |
Инструменты поддержки рабочих процессов
Для успешного управления микросервисной архитектурой и поддержкой удалённых команд широко применяются такие инструменты, как:
- Платформы для CI/CD (непрерывной интеграции и доставки), ускоряющие разработку и тестирование;
- Системы управления проектами (Jira, Trello), позволяющие отслеживать задачи и прогресс в режиме реального времени;
- Коммуникационные платформы (Slack, Microsoft Teams), обеспечивающие быстрый обмен информацией и проведение онлайн-встреч;
- Мониторинговые системы, контролирующие работу сервисов и выявляющие сбои;
- Контейнеризационные технологии (Docker, Kubernetes), упрощающие развертывание и масштабирование сервисов.
Изменения в корпоративной культуре под влиянием новых подходов
Микроуслуги и удалённые команды оказывают глубокое влияние на корпоративную культуру игровых студий. Они способствуют формированию более гибкой, ориентированной на результат и сотрудничество среды.
Происходит сдвиг от иерархического управления к модельям, где ценятся автономия, ответственность и доверие. Корпоративные ценности и традиции адаптируются к работе в условиях географической рассредоточенности и технологической сложности.
Основные черты новой корпоративной культуры
- Децентрализация принятия решений — команды имеют свободу выбора технических средств и методов работы;
- Прозрачность и открытость — обмен знаниями и информацией становится стандартом;
- Акцент на результат — внимание смещается с количества часов на качество и эффективность;
- Гибкость и адаптивность — способность быстро реагировать на изменения и новые вызовы;
- Поддержка мультикультурности — развитие толерантности и уважения к различным культурам и стилям работы.
Вызовы и методы поддержки корпоративной культуры
Поддержание сплочённости и мотивации в распределённых командах требует активных усилий со стороны руководства. Важно создавать возможности для неформального общения, поощрять коллегиальную помощь и проводить регулярные ретроспективы.
Одним из эффективных инструментов становится организация виртуальных тимбилдингов, обучающих программ и чёткое формирование миссии проекта, объединяющей всех участников. Внедрение систем нематериального поощрения и признания также способствует укреплению корпоративного духа.
Заключение
Микроуслуги и удалённые команды радикально меняют подход к разработке игр в крупных студиях. Они позволяют повысить гибкость, масштабируемость и качество игровых проектов, одновременно предъявляя новые требования к организации рабочего процесса и корпоративной культуре.
Для успешной интеграции этих подходов необходимо инвестировать в технические инструменты, развивать коммуникации и культуру доверия, а также адаптировать менеджмент к современным реалиям. Только так крупные игровые студии смогут эффективно конкурировать на глобальном рынке и создавать продукты мирового уровня в условиях быстроменяющейся игровой индустрии.
Как внедрение микроуслуг влияет на масштабируемость игровых проектов в крупных студиях?
Микроуслуги позволяют разбивать крупные игровые проекты на независимые компоненты, что облегчает масштабирование отдельных частей игры без необходимости переработки всей системы. Это повышает гибкость разработки и ускоряет выпуск обновлений, улучшая пользовательский опыт.
Какие вызовы возникают при управлении удаленной командой в игровой индустрии, и как их можно преодолеть?
Главными вызовами являются проблемы коммуникации, различия в часовых поясах и поддержание командного духа. Для их преодоления компании используют современные инструменты для видеосвязи и совместной работы, внедряют гибкие графики и организуют регулярные виртуальные тимбилдинги, что помогает сохранить мотивацию и сплоченность команды.
Как изменение корпоративной культуры под воздействием удаленной работы отражается на креативности и инновациях в игровых студиях?
Удаленная работа способствует большей автономии сотрудников и разнообразию идей за счет привлечения специалистов из разных регионов. Однако она требует более чётких процессов и активного обмена знаниями для поддержания креативности. В итоге корпоративная культура становится более адаптивной и ориентированной на результат.
Каким образом микроуслуги способствуют улучшению качества игровых продуктов?
Поскольку микроуслуги разрабатываются и тестируются отдельно, это позволяет быстрее выявлять и исправлять ошибки в конкретных элементах игры. Такой подход повышает надежность, упрощает интеграцию новых функций и позволяет легче адаптироваться к требованиям игроков.
Как крупные игровые студии балансируют между централизованным управлением и автономией удаленных команд в условиях микроуслуг?
Студии часто вводят стандарты и процессы, обеспечивающие единые технические и коммуникационные рамки, при этом давая командам свободу в реализации решений. Это создает баланс между контролем качества и инновациями, позволяя эффективно управлять сложными проектами с распределенными ресурсами.